Are we animals? Humans belong to the animal kingdom according to science/taxonomy( taxonomy is the classification of living things according to their biological origin, design, and similarities). Hence; Humans are considered to be animals. However i disagree with the classification, even though; 1. All mammals are animals. 2. Humans are mammals. Therefore; 3. Humans are animals. And; 1. Only animals have eukaeyotic cells. 2. Human have eukaryotic cells. Therefore; 4. Humans are animals. And; 1. All heterotrophs are animals. 2. Humans are heterotrophs. Therefore; 3. Humans are animals. Why do i disagree? I disagree with the classification because; To say(for example)("I am an animal"), does not make sense. For such a proposition is directed to person-hood. However "the I" is not an animal. Hence; Even though human anatomy is very similar to animal anatomy, it does not follow that we are animals. For we are distinct from them in terms of "person-hood". Therefore; It is irrational for me to say that "I am" an "animal". For "I" am a person. But; an animal is not a "person". Do not get me wrong. I accept that our bodies are very similar(even often identical) to an animals body. However; i do not accept that our essence of person-hood is the same as the essence of an animal. And consequently, it does not follow that we are animals since "I" is not the same as an animals "I"(it is reasonable to believe that animals have an I/or self). For there is a clear distinction between our essence of person-hood and the animal self. So; We may reason as follows; 1. Taxonomy pertains to the classification(on grounds of similarities) of organisms with other organisms. Hence; 2. Humans are classified as animals based on anatomical similarities. Hence; 3. It is our anatomy that is similar to the anatomy of animals. Hence; 4. if we are not our anatomy, then we do not share any similarities with animals in terms of personhood. 5. We are not our anatomy. Hence; 6. We share no similarities with animals in terms of personhood. Therefore; 7. We are not animals. The argument above is based on personhood/self.
